Feicht
Feicht is a hamlet in Münzkirchen, Schärding District, Upper Austria and has about 54 residents. Feicht is situated nearby to the hamlet Reikersham, as well as near Freundorf.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Neuburg am Inn
Village
Photo: Konrad Lackerbeck, CC BY 3.0.
Neuburg am Inn is a municipality in the district of Passau in Bavaria in Germany. Neuburg lies high above the river Inn, which forms the natural border with Austria. Neuburg am Inn is situated 7 km west of Feicht.
